Islamabad, 2 February 2022 (TDI): Pakistan’s Minister for Information, Chaudhry Fawad Hussain said that Pakistan and Egypt enjoy incredibly strong relations. He gave the before-mentioned remarks while he was in a meeting with the Ambassador of Egypt to Pakistan Doctor Tarek Dahroug, on Wednesday in Islamabad.

While having a conversation with the Egyptian Ambassador to Pakistan, Doctor Tarek Dahroug, the Minister for Information Chaudhry Fawad Hussain shed light on other matters too.

Chaudhry Fawad Hussain stated that the masses of both countries are united over various factors. To be precise three main factors were mentioned. Religion, culture, and the existing brotherly relationship.

Cultural heritage was specifically talked about. The potential and resources associated with it were emphasized. In this regard, the two dignitaries also agreed upon the establishment, of dubbing centers.

The purpose of these centers would be to translate the films, movies, and dramas. By doing so they will be understandable for both nations.

Not only that but various other areas and sectors of mutual interests were underscored.
Drama, film, regional, and international situations were among the few topics that were highlighted.

Earlier attempts in the same year to strengthen bilateral relations

Apart from the earlier mentioned meeting, steps are also being taken in Egypt to deepen the ties between the two countries. In the previous month, on 31 January 2022, Pakistan Embassy in Egypt took to its official Twitter account to inform about a significant meeting.

The meeting was between Ambassador Sajid Bilal and the President of Al Azhar University Professor Doctor Muhammed Hussain Al Mahrasawi. The venue of the meeting was Al Azhar University, Cairo.

Basically, Sajid Bilal paid a visit to the university and during the visit, he met the President and had discussions. The discussion was about how to further strengthen the already existing partnership between Al Azhar University and the universities of Pakistan.
